Med en Business Intelligence (BI)-marknad som blir allt större och mer svåröverskådlig blir det viktigare att företagen som ska köpa in BI-verktyg vet vad de behöver. Men vilka faktorer spelar egentligen in när företag ska välja den här typen av system? För att kunna besvara denna fråga har vi genomfört en undersökning där fem stora tillverkande företag intervjuats via telefon. Intervjuerna genomfördes för att få en tydligare bild över vilka faktorer som spelar roll vid val av BI-verktyg samt om faktorerna som presenterats i tidigare forskning stämmer överrens med vad företagen ser som viktigt. Resultatet visar att de viktigaste faktorerna för företagen är användbarhet följt av funktionalitet, kvalitet, pris och sist utbildning. Systemvalet påverkas även av det kontaktnät som företagen har och rådgivande företag som Gartner har en stor påverkan på vilket system som väljs. Även leverantören spelar stor roll när ett system ska väljas. (Less)

As the Business Intelligence (BI) market is growing, and thus becoming harder to grasp, there is an increasing need for companies to know what they require when purchasing a system within this field. The question becomes, what factors are important when companies choose this type of system? In order to answer this, a study was conducted in which five large manufacturing companies were interviewed. These interviews were conducted in order to gain a better understanding of which factors are important within the process of selecting a BI-tool. In addition, the aforementioned interviews allowed for us to crosscheck whether or not these factors complied with previous research. The most important factor for these companies is usability; followed by functionality, quality, price, and lastly, user training. The companies’ corporate networks also influence the software selection. Consulting companies, such as Gartner, have a strong influence on such selections. Furthermore, the system supplier plays a large role in the system selection process. (Less)
